Common Curb Repair Jobs
Concrete sidewalk repair - restores uneven or cracked sidewalks for safety and appearance.
Driveway crack filling - addresses surface cracks to prevent further damage and maintain curb appeal.
Paver repair - replaces or realigns damaged pavers to ensure a smooth, durable surface.
Curbstone replacement - replaces broken or crumbling curbstones to improve street drainage and aesthetics.
Drainage curb repair - fixes damaged curbs to ensure proper water runoff and prevent flooding.
Concrete slab patching - repairs sunken or damaged slabs to restore level surfaces and safety.
Curb Repair Questions
What types of curb damage can be repaired? Common curb repairs include cracks, chips, uneven surfaces, and minor structural damage caused by weather or impact.
How do I know if my curb needs repair? Signs include visible cracks, unevenness, sinking, or damage that affects safety or aesthetics.
Are curb repairs suitable for all curb materials? Repairs can be performed on various materials such as concrete, asphalt, or stone, depending on the specific damage.
What are common reasons to consider curb repair? Curb repair helps improve curb appeal, prevent further deterioration, and maintain property safety and functionality.
